Key Findings:
- The analysis compared WES-measured TMB with commercially available targeted panel estimates of TMB and found discordance in 10-15% of cases, with error rates correlating to panel size.
- In discordant cases, WES TMB more accurately predicted overall survival in pembrolizumab-treated patients than panel-based estimates.
- In a subset of ‘TMB reliant’ patients (n = 3,981), for example, patients with tumor types that lack disease-specific immune checkpoint inhibitor indications, the median overall survival in discordant cases was about five months longer for WES TMB-High and panel TMB-Low compared to WES TMB-Low and panel TMB-High cases treated with pembrolizumab.
